Migrate all CLI command handlers from cobra's Run to RunE, replacing fmt.Println(err) + os.Exit(1) patterns with idiomatic error returns. This improves testability and lets cobra handle errors consistently via the existing SilenceUsage/SilenceErrors configuration. Also refactor getDuration() and getTime() helpers to return errors instead of calling os.Exit(1). Fix a bug in group.go where the error from inspector.Groups() was never checked, causing silent failures (e.g. on Redis connection errors) to be misreported as "No groups found".
